Car Insurance: AXA offers various tiers of auto insurance from basic third-party plans to more expansive options. Those seeking comprehensive coverage receive a bounty of perks including windshield repair or replacement without deduction from their policy limits, supplemental medical payouts for injuries sustained in a covered incident, and temporary vehicle loans while repairs are undertaken.
Home Protection: Homeowners safeguard both their dwellings and possessions under AXA’s residential insurance choices, which provide flexibility to add protection for unintended fractures and legal costs. Policyholders can personalize the extent of their safekeeping in proportion to their one-of-a-kind needs, freedoms, and risk tolerance. Costs may fluctuate according to the amount and kind of coverage obtained, but numerous alternatives exist to craft the perfect fit.
Health Insurance: AXA provides health insurance plans covering numerous medical treatments and services. Policyholders can opt for varying coverage levels including outpatient care, psychological aid, and dental work. This ensures that the insured have access to essential care without unforeseen medical costs coming as a shock.
Travel Insurance: AXA crafted travel insurance to shelter voyagers from an array of dangers on their excursions like health crises while away from home, cancelled trips, and misplaced luggage leaving travelers stranded. Whether exploring occasionally or constantly on the move, the company’s single outings or year-long multi-trips policies have touring covered.

4. Discounts and Rewards
AXA provides numerous ways for customers to save on insurance premiums. For example, owning multiple policies results in substantial multi-policy savings. Those with spotless driving records also gain from experience-based discounts that progressively reduce costs. Such discounts make AXA’s plans increasingly affordable and appealing to a vast array of individuals.
Customer Loyalty: AXA loyalty programs repay devoted customers with extra discounts and advantages, motivating policyholders to remain with the company for extended periods. These programs regularly include perks like boosted coverage choices, priority rates, and admission to exclusive services. 5. Innovative Technology Solutions
AXA has embraced technology to enhance its services and improve the customer experience. The company’s customizable mobile app offers a diverse array of innovative features that enable customers to skillfully govern their policies anytime, anywhere. Through this versatile app, policyholders can keenly examine coverage particulars, effortlessly render payments, rapidly initiate claims, or even solicit instant quotations for novel policies. AXA’s application of technology also extends to its claims handling, where customers can deftly upload documents and actively track cases online, rendering the process more clear and proficient.
Telematics: For automobile insurance, AXA presents telematics-driven policies utilizing a device or mobile app to vigilantly observe driving behavior. Cautious motorists can benefit from lower premiums contingent on their habitudes behind the wheel, which not only preserves finances but also promotes safer driving conduct.

2. A Limited Network of Branches
In contrast to several insurance providers that operate numerous storefronts nationwide, AXA maintains a modest collection of physical locations in the UK. While the company delivers robust online services and accessible phone support, clients who prefer face-to-face interactions may find the scarcity of brick-and-mortar branches inconvenient. This can be problematically so for individuals who feel unsettled utilizing digital platforms or who appreciate visualizing their insurance agent when addressing matters of coverage.
